The idea behind the Innovation Barn is to create jobs while growing businesses that reuse waste materials.

Envision Charlotte

The Innovation Barn has a glass crusher that takes recycled glass and turns it into sand for repurposing. They also take certain types of plastics and turn those into products like bricks and benches, according to Aussieker. The city began its circular economy efforts in 2018, after China stopped importing certain recyclables, including plastic and mixed paper. Cities like Charlotte had to pay higher rates for recycling or stop altogether. Charlotte decided to follow the example of the circular economy action plan that the European Union adopted in 2015.

The City of Charlotte owns the building and Envision Charlotte manages, designs, and implements the programming within. A circular economy has zero waste — its waste products are re-used or up-cycled, instead of going to landfills. Some of the projects at Innovation Barn are aquaponics, a mushroom garden, a plastics lab, a teaching kitchen, a cafe, and more. Innovation Barn, at 932 Seigle Avenue, Charlotte, North Carolina, is a joint project by Envision Charlotte and the City of Charlotte, with the goal of transitioning Charlotte to a circular economy. It’s a combination of entrepreneurial businesses, zero-waste initiatives, and a space to bring groups together in order to learn more about and implement circular projects. The City of Charlotte rents the building to Envision Charlotte for $1 a year.

The City of Charlotte owns the building, while Envision Charlotte is responsible for managing, designing, and executing its multifaceted programs. Two years ago, local environmentalists and some city staff members expressed reservations about the project's cost and intent. The Innovation Barn wound up costing double the initial budget approved by Charlotte City Council and opened two years later than projected.

Attach several rodent glue traps to a board such as a 2x4 and position against the base of a wall—where most snakes tend to travel. As the snake brushes against the glue traps, it will become stuck. This is completely non-lethal if they are not left on there for extended periods of time. Afterward, remove the board—watch out for the end that bites—and take it somewhere outside. To remove the snake, simply pour a generous amount of cooking oil over the surface.

The staffing rating takes into account differences in the levels of residents' care needs in each nursing home. For example, a nursing home with residents that have more health problems would be expected to have more nursing staff than a nursing home where the residents need less health care. It does not indicate that the facility meets official state requirements for level of care. Since humectants slow water from evaporating in the epidermis, they help to keep the skin hydrated. Humectants also provide temporary anti-aging effects because the extra hydration is extra volume, which effectively plumps out the skin and makes lines and wrinkles less noticeable. However, this effect is transient – as soon as the moisture content in skin decreases, lines and wrinkles will return to normal size. The key ingredients in Charlotte Tilbury Magic Cream are claimed to be hyaluronic acid, vitamins C and E, camellia oil, rosehip oil, shea butter, aloe vera, and frangipani flower extract. However, we’d like to point out that all of these “key” ingredients are present in very low concentrations (less than 1%). We know this by looking at the ingredient list (which is in order of descending concentrations).
